Black, red and yellow painting of two zoomorphic figures standing, one on top of the other, on Sisiutl's head. The bottom figure holds a copper that it bites with a long snout. The top figure is bird-like and stands with large, open wings. From the central head, Sisiutl curls up on either side along the outer edges of the paper. "David Matilpi" is inscribed in black ink in the upper left corner.
Pencil drawing of a bird in flight holding a whale in its talons. Bird has an extended tongue. Both whale and bird are covered with curvilinear and geometric designs that resemble elements of Northwest Coast style. Red numeral two and "No2" inscribed in upper left corner.
Pencil line drawing of a zoomorphic figure covered in curvilinear and geometric designs. Number sixty-six written in red, near upper left corner.
Bilaterally symmetrical Northwest Coast style image of a bear in black, red, blue and brown; paper with image drawn on it is glued to a larger piece of paper. Ink inscription near the upper right corner of the larger paper reads: "Tsimshian House front Painting representing the Bear."
Reductive pencil line drawing of a whale; curved dorsal fin, sharp teeth, outwardly curved tail fin, curvilinear designs. Red numeral four in upper right corner. "No4" inscribed in pencil in upper left corner.

Rectangular basket with plaited bottom that curves upward to twined walls whose warp it made of the strips of the base. Four dark bands of decoration go around walls; the bands are in groups of two and separate the height into thirds.
Carved walking stick with claw around ball for top and small leather tie below handle. Staff is decorated with carvings in relief that are painted with black and red in areas.
Spoon with shallow horn scoop hafted to another pointed horn. The inside surface of the bowl has incised decorations with inlaid shell and copper(?) decorations. The handle is carved in relief and also has inlaid shell decorations.
Heart-shaped pouch with opening at one of the lobes. Top flat is folded back and a miniature hat of braided bark and a heart pendant of leather are attached to centre of folded back part. A blue piece of cloth with a printed Green and gold maple leaf with the words, "Naas River," underneath is tucked into pouch; pendant has letters, "L.L." stitched onto front. Back of pouch has embroidered letters, "S.M.P."
